@charset "Shift_JIS";/*----中央ギャラリー　ここから----*/div#itembox{	position:relative;	width:510px;	height:650px;	background:url('../images/itembox_bg.jpg') no-repeat 48px 59px;}div#itembox div.item{	width:120px;	height:120px;	position:absolute;}div#itembox div.item p{	text-align:left;	margin-top:10px;	color:#ffffff;}div#item1{	top:69px;	left:48px;}div#item2{	top:69px;	left:195px;}div#item3{	top:69px;	left:342px;}div#item4{	top:201px;	left:48px;}div#item5{	top:201px;	left:195px;}div#item6{	top:201px;	left:342px;}div#item7{	top:334px;	left:48px;}div#item8{	top:334px;	left:195px;}div#item9{	top:334px;	left:342px;}div#item10{	top:467px;	left:48px;}div#item11{	top:467px;	left:195px;}div#item12{	top:467px;	left:342px;}div#pre_btn,div#next_btn{	position:absolute;	width:26px;	height:26px;	top:594px;}div#pre_btn{	left:109px;	background:url('../images/pre_btn_bg.gif') no-repeat;}div#next_btn{	left:377px;	background:url('../images/next_btn_bg.gif') no-repeat;}div#pre_btn a,div#next_btn a{	display:block;}div#pre_btn img,div#next_btn img{	visibility:hidden;}div#pre_btn a:hover img,div#next_btn a:hover img{	visibility:visible;}div#pre_btn a:hover,div#next_btn a:hover{	background-color:transparent;}p.listnum{	position:absolute;	top:594px;	left:135px;	width:245px;	height:23px;	color:#ffffff;	font-size:1em;}/*----中央ギャラリー　ここまで----*//*----右メニュー　ここから----*/div#gmenu{	position:relative;	width:232px;	height:650px;}#gmenu ul{	list-style-type:none;	margin:0px;	position:absolute;	top:360px;	left:0px;	width:232px;	height:210px;	background:url('../images/gmenu_bg.jpg') no-repeat;}#gmenu ul.en{	background:url('../images/gmenu_bg_e.jpg') no-repeat!important;}#gmenu li{	width:232px;	height:42px;}#gmenu li a{	display:block;}#gmenu li img{	visibility:hidden;}#gmenu a:hover img,#gmenu li.selected img{	visibility:visible;}#gmenu a:hover{	background-color:transparent;}/*----メニュー　ここまで----*//*----右イメージ　ここから----*/div#imgbox{	position:absolute;	top:0px;	left:-30px;	z-index:100;	width:262px;	height:271px;	background:url('../images/imgbox_bg.jpg') no-repeat;}div#imgbox_in{	position:relative;	width:262px;	height:271px;}#imgbox div.largeimg{	visibility:hidden;	position:absolute;	top:0px;	left:0px;	text-align:center;}#imgbox div.default{	visibility:visible;}#imgbox div.img{	height:168px;	margin:51px 0px 5px 0px;}#imgbox div.img_info{	padding:0px 24px 0px 14px;}#imgbox div.img_info p.itemnum{	width:200px;	float:left;	text-align:left;}#imgbox div.img_info div.enlarge_btn{	width:16px;	float:right;}/*----右イメージ　ここまで----*//*----拡大イメージ　ここから----*/body.largeimg{	margin:20px;}div.iteminfo{	margin-top:5px;}.iteminfo p.itemname{	float:left;	text-align:left;}.iteminfo p.buyordie{	float:right;	width:100px;	text-align:right;}div.detail{	display:none;}div.detail_in{	padding:20px;}/*----拡大イメージ　ここまで----*/